New “Tintin” Video Game In The Works

Microids and Moulinsart are developing a video game based on the iconic French comic book series “The Adventures of Tintin”.

The title being created for both consoles and PC and will be an action-adventure game transporting players into a whirlwind of suspenseful situations with intrepid reporter Tintin, his loveable dog Snowy, and other iconic characters like Captain Haddock, Professor Calculus and detectives Thomson & Thompson.

Microids CEO Stéphane Longeard said in a statement: “We are extremely happy to work on this co-production. We have been willing to make this happen for quite some time. This announcement is the result of a creative process allowing us to define precisely how this project will take shape and the two companies will interact. This really is a dream come true for us.”

The aim is to reportedly provide a “mainstream audience with a fun and friendly game for everyone to enjoy.” Microids previously published the “Syberia” and “Blacksad” games, while Moulinsart is the company which has been set up to protect and promote the work of “Tintin” author Herge.

“Tintin” was adapted into three side scrolling games in the 1990s, along with a quickly cobbled together point and click game based on Steven Spielberg’s 2011 film.
